Weekly bulletin 10.08-17.08.2012

date

21 август 2012

Sofix registered a growth of 2.4 % last week and is very close to its levels from the beginning of the year. With the largest contribution to this increase were increases in Bulgartabac of 9.7 % and a growth of 6.35 % in Monbat, and 4.6 % in Advance Terrafund REIT. The other three indexes also ended at plus. Positive was the wave also on developed exchanges and from the exchanges tracked by us only in Hong Kong was registered a slight decline.

The week that ended on Aug 17, was rich in macroeconomic data - unemployment in July this year remained unchanged from June at a level of 10.8 %, according to data of Employment Agency. Compared to July last year, when they accounted for 9.47 %, the data show an increase. In July this year the work received just over 18,000 unemployed, with 4,000 people more than in July 2011 This is due to the larger number of new recruits, using incentives of social ministry, and those financed under the Operational Programme "Human Resources Development", it said in the statement of the EA.

On Monday, NSI announced data on inflation - the consumer price index for July 2012 to June 2012 was 101.5 %, i.e. monthly inflation was 1.5 %. Inflation from the beginning of the year (July 2012 to December 2011) was 2.1 % and annual inflation in July 2012 compared to July 2011 was 3.1 %. The average inflation for the period August 2011 - July 2012 compared to the period August 2010 - July 2011 was 2.6 %.

 In the second quarter of 2012, GDP grew by 0.5 % over the same quarter of the previous year and 0.2 % compared to the first quarter of 2012, show flash estimates of national statistics. For the same period versus the first quarter, the GDP of the EU-27 decreased by 0.2 %. In the second quarter of 2012 compared to the previous quarter, the highest growth recorded Sweden - 1.4 %, Latvia - 1.0 %, Slovakia - 0.7 %, and Romania - by 0.5 %, while Portugal, Spain, Cyprus, the UK and Italy registered a decrease by 1.2, 1.0, 0.8, 0.7 and 0.7 %.

Collective investment schemes managed by the "UBB Asset Management" reported increases, as UBB Premium Equity was the best represented fund while UBB Platinum Bond stepped back 0.27 % of its value.
